The Symbolism of Radha Krishna
Radha and Krishna together symbolize the essence of love and devotion. Their relationship represents the soul’s yearning for the divine, illustrating the deepest connection between human emotion and spiritual experience. Through their playful interactions and heartfelt exchanges, they embody the notion of divine love that transcends physical boundaries and resonates on a spiritual plane. This union serves as a reminder that love, in its purest form, is a connection that elevates the soul.
The imagery of Radha and Krishna often portrays their distinct yet harmonious characteristics. Krishna, known for his playful and mischievous nature, is the embodiment of love and joy. In contrast, Radha represents devotion, purity, and the ideal of love. Together, they signify the balance of these qualities, showcasing how love can encompass a range of emotions and experiences. Their divine romance teaches us about the importance of surrender and the bliss that arises from a loving relationship with the divine.
Additionally, their symbolism is reflected in the colors and elements present in their images. The vibrant blue of Krishna signifies the infinite and the universe, while Radha’s delicate forms often portray grace and beauty. The lotus flower frequently associated with them symbolizes purity and spiritual awakening. Together, these elements create a rich tapestry of meaning, inviting viewers into a deeper exploration of love's multifaceted nature.
